Newport is moderately more affordable than Marshallville, with a 5.2% lower cost of living index. Marshallville scores 102 compared to 97 for Newport,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Marshallville can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.

When it comes to buying, median home values in Marshallville are $339,700 compared to $197,500 in Newport, a 72% gap.

Median household income in Marshallville is $170,197 compared to $64,327 in Newport (+164.6%). While Marshallville is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
